in Maxima, how is it possible to simply equations that are components of a matrix? I have a rather big matrix and want to simplify the components of it (e.g. factor out and cancel out).

Most functions (where appropriate) already thread over lists, matrices, equations, etc...
For example:
(%i1) a : [[cos(x)^2+sin(x)^2,1],[0,sin(x)*cos(x)]];
2 2
(%o1) [[sin (x) + cos (x), 1], [0, cos(x) sin(x)]]
(%i2) trigsimp(a);
(%o2) [[1, 1], [0, cos(x) sin(x)]]
(%i3) trigreduce(a);
cos(2 x) + 1 1 - cos(2 x) sin(2 x)
(%o3) [[------------ + ------------, 1], [0, --------]]
2 2 2
(%i4) expand(%o3);
sin(2 x)
(%o4) [[1, 1], [0, --------]]
2
If this doesn't help you, can you give more details of the problem that you're having?
